Understanding the Core Mechanics of the Chicken Road Game

At its heart, the chicken road game is a test of reaction time. Players typically control a chicken with simple tap or click controls, aiming to navigate it safely across a relentlessly busy road. The speed and density of traffic are the primary challenges, requiring players to carefully observe gaps and time their movements accordingly. Success is measured by how far the chicken can travel before inevitably meeting a vehicular demise. The game’s simplicity is a key part of its appeal, making it easy for anyone to pick up and play. However, mastering the timing and anticipating traffic patterns is crucial for achieving high scores and extended play times.

The game is often presented with vibrant, cartoonish graphics, adding to its playful ambience. Sound effects, such as clucking chickens and honking cars, further enhance the immersive experience. Many variations of the game introduce power-ups or obstacles, such as speed boosts or moving barriers, adding an extra layer of complexity. These additions prevent the gameplay from becoming monotonous and reward skillful play.

The inherent randomness of the traffic patterns ensures that each playthrough is unique, preventing players from simply memorizing a sequence of movements. This constant unpredictability keeps the game engaging and challenging, even for experienced players. The satisfyingly frustrating cycle of dodging cars, narrowly escaping collisions, and ultimately succumbing to the erratic flow of vehicles is what keeps people coming back for more.

Strategies for Mastering the Crossings

While luck plays a role in the chicken road game, employing specific strategies significantly increases a player’s chances of success. Observation is paramount. Pay close attention to the patterns of traffic, noting the intervals between vehicles and predicting their movements. Don’t rush; waiting for a clear and sizable gap is often preferable to attempting a risky dash. Patience can be the key to longevity in the game.

Furthermore, understanding the game’s nuances can provide an edge. Some variations feature subtle cues regarding upcoming traffic, or the speed of vehicles might change dynamically. Being attuned to these variables allows for more informed decision-making. Practice also enhances muscle memory and improves reaction time, leading to more consistent and successful crossings.

Many players find that focusing on a specific point on the screen, rather than constantly following the chicken, helps maintain a better sense of distance and timing. This technique minimizes distractions and promotes a more deliberate approach. Using short, controlled taps or clicks is also more effective than holding down the control, which can result in erratic movements.

The Psychological Appeal of a Simple Challenge

The enduring popularity of the chicken road game stems from its ability to provide a simple, yet compelling challenge. The inherent risk-reward mechanics tap into our innate desire for excitement and the satisfaction of overcoming obstacles. The game’s accessible nature allows players of all ages and skill levels to enjoy a sense of accomplishment.

The unpredictable nature of the game also contributes to its addictive quality. Each playthrough presents a fresh set of challenges, preventing boredom and encouraging repeated attempts. The immediacy of feedback – success or failure – reinforces engagement and motivates players to constantly refine their strategies. The quick round structure allows for short bursts of play, making it ideal for filling idle moments.

Furthermore, the game’s lighthearted and whimsical nature provides a welcome escape from the stresses of everyday life. The simple goal of guiding a chicken across the road is a harmless and endearing pursuit, offering a moment of levity and uncomplicated entertainment.
